5.2.3.3

clear snmp access

Use this command to clear the SNMP access entry of a specific group, including its set SNMP
security-model, and level of security.

clear snmp access groupname security-model {v1 | v2 | v3 {noauth | auth |
authpriv}}

Syntax Description

Command Defaults

None.

Command Type

Switch command.

Command Mode

Read-Write.

Example

This example shows how to clear SNMP version 3 access for the “mis-group”:

groupname

Specifies the name of the SNMP group for which to clear
access.

security-model v1 |
v2
| v3

Specifies the security model to be cleared for the SNMP
access group.

noauth | auth |
authpriv

Clears a specific security level for the SNMPv3 access
group.

Matrix>clear snmp access mis-group security-model v3 authpriv
